National developer Crest team up with Curo to build new homes at Hygge Park

Bath-based Curo has started works on site at Crest Nicholson’s residential development of 250 homes in Keynsham, Hygge Park. The housing association and housebuilder will work alongside the national developer to build 56 homes on a parcel of the site, known as the ‘Woodland View at Hygge Park’.

Curo & residents join forces to spruce up new meeting room

Residents living at Rosewell Court in Bath now have a freshly decorated meeting room for their new residents’ association to use. Residents and Curo colleagues teamed up on 23 October to give the meeting room at Rosewell Court a lick of paint.

Meet the new team taking care of Curo's estates

Meet Curo’s team of hands-on caretakers. The team work in some of our larger estates, keeping shared areas tidy and carrying out minor repairs in communal areas straight away without the need to wait for a job to be booked.
